In this case the previous days closing price will be the equilibrium or call-auction price.

Remember
Limit orders will get precedence over market orders during execution.
All market orders will be executed at the determined equilibrium price or call-auction price.
All limit orders that are not executed will be moved to the regular trading session.
A uniform 20% price band is applicable to all eligible stocks during these 15 minutes
